What is Счётчик оборотов вала?
In this glossary, Счётчик оборотов вала refers to: A device or system that records the number of revolutions of the propulsion shaft, providing critical speed and distance data.
How is Счётчик оборотов вала used in maritime?
In maritime communication, this term appears in contexts such as: "Проверяйте показания счётчика оборотов вала каждый час и заносите их в журнал для подтверждения точности данных о движении."
